Disappointed in how rough they are!
When I first opened the packing and felt the sheet, I thought they were going to be soft and smooth like the old Percale sheets were....and slick, no iron! But after washing, they felt very course and rough...and wrinkled The sheets and cases are very heavy, rough, ..like sleeping on a pair of denim jeans! My face felt almost burned in the morning from the pillowcase. The color is vibrant and held up well in washing. If you like a very smooth, soft sheet, these are not what you want. I am very disappointed in my purchase.

Striking sheet set
Like the colors and oversized Cal King top sheet. Smooth material washed nicely first time. Reserving opinion on bottom sheet fit - elastic seams looser fit on 19” high mattress. This is a One -way directional pattern, so I’m dealing with the aesthetics of 3 pieces being “railroaded” cut, for cutting corners. This would not have been such an enticing price point if all the pieces had been cut/sewn with the 1-way directional pattern, it would have been 4 or 5times more expensive! Yes, I can throw a comforter over the sheets and hide the incongruity, alas, not my style!
